Dickens, Charles (1812-1870)
Oliver Twist, a fine first edition in original cloth.

London: Richard Bentley, 1838.

First edition, first issue in book form, three octavo volumes; half-titles and advertisements present in volumes I and III; illustrated with three etched frontispieces and 21 plates by George Cruishank, including the scarce "Fireside Plate" in volume III; in a plum cloth variant binding, horizontally ribbed and without the publisher's imprint at spine foot, boards blind-stamped with an arabesque, spine gilt-lettered, yellow coated endpapers (fresh interior, with only three repaired marginal tears to page 189 in vol. I and two plates; recased, with small repairs at corners, gilt lettering faded on vol. III); together in a custom red cloth chemise and full morocco pull-off box; 7 7/8 x 4 3/4 in.

A remarkably preserved copy of Dickens's famous second title in which he diverges from his preceding Pickwick Papers by focusing on a young protagonist.

Eckel, pp. 59-63; Podeschi/Gimbel A27; Sadleir 696; Smith 4.
